About this home

Discover your sanctuary in this enchanting hillside hideaway, where timeless charm meets modern comfort. This 4-bedroom, 3.5-bathroom retreat is perched above the canyons, capturing sweeping views of rolling hills and glittering city lights. The main level features an airy, open-concept floor plan with a sun-drenched living room, dining area, and a chef-ready kitchen all framed by floor-to-ceiling windows that invite in the natural beauty surrounding you. The serene primary suite offers a private escape with panoramic views and an elegant en-suite bath. Two additional bedrooms provide inviting accommodations for guests or family. Downstairs, an expansive 760 sq ft unpermitted basement space offers tremendous flexibility. It includes an additional bedroom, full bath, and kitchenette ideal for guests, extended family, a creative studio setup or ADU rental with its own private entrance. Step outside to experience two distinct outdoor sanctuaries: a generous 1,000-square-foot lounge patio perfect for entertaining under the stars, and a separate 650-square-foot deck for tranquil mornings or intimate sunset dinners. The home also includes over 1,500 square feet of enhanced living space, featuring a versatile multipurpose room and a private gym to keep your lifestyle active and inspired. Tucked just minutes from world-class shopping and dining in Beverly Hills, this hillside haven offers the perfect blend of peaceful retreat and urban convenience.
